The HVY Future Shock Scarab is a custom low-profile light tank featured in Grand Theft Auto Online as part of the Arena War update.

Design[]

Grand Theft Auto Online[]

The vehicle assumes the same design as the Apocalypse, but has a cleaner bodywork. The top frame of the front bumper is finished in carbon fiber and most of the vehicle's details are painted, such as the side vents and the panels between the body frames. The rusty bed floor from the Apocalypse variant is replaced by a clean one with an hexagonal pattern on it, while the rear wall has a carbon-fiber finish. The LED floodlight bar has a perforated sheet metal texture on the rear, similar to the front bumper of the Future Shock Cerberus.

The primary color of the vehicle is applied on the bodywork, front bumper, side vents, the panels between the body frames, the LED floodlight bar, the sides of the tracks, the track wheel casings, the suspension arm pivots, the lower details of the suspension shocks and the details of the steering wheel, while the secondary color is applied on the details around the front bumper, the top section of the bumper near the winch, the protective frames, the details around the door handles, the surroundings of the side vents, the details around the tail lights, the details on the track wheel casings, the outer surrounding of the track systems and the suspension springs. An accent color is also available for the inner surrounding of the track systems, the details of the suspension arm pivots and the upper details of the suspension shocks. The vehicle uses a modernized set of continuous tracks, which have smaller road wheel casings with flexible sections in between, together with hexagonal patterns on the treads.

The vehicle can be equipped with a top-mounted gun on the roof, being either a machine gun resembling a Browning M2HB or a futuristic plasma/laser gun.

Performance[]

Grand Theft Auto Online[]

Vehicle[]

The Scarab accelerates fairly quick compared to other tracked vehicles and possess above average handling, as well as extremely good braking capabilities. The Scarab's biggest weakness, however, is its mediocre top speed; even with boost, it is unable to pass 75 miles an hour. While having good suspension, scoop upgrades may hinder its capabilities.

Although it is not heavy enough to crush cars like the Rhino Tank or the TM-02 Khanjali, the Scarab can still pose a threat towards anyone. The vehicle can push away vehicles with ease and is difficult to be pushed by other light cars, making it an excellent choice for transportation around the map.

The vehicle is powered by a diesel engine located around the middle section, given the location of the vents. It shares the same engine sound with vehicles like the Phantom Custom, the Hauler Custom and the Chernobog.

Abilities[]

  • The vehicle can be installed with both "Jump" mods and "Shunt" mods. The Jump modifications come in three levels of effectiveness and can be activated using the horn button. When activated, the vehicle will be launched into the air, in a similar way to the Ruiner 2000 and Scramjet. The Shunt modifications allow the vehicle to shunt to the side.
  • The vehicle can be installed with Boost upgrades. This can be used to significantly speed up the vehicle. It can be used repeatedly while driving the vehicle, but it is better to let it fully recharge for maximum efficiency.

Armor[]

Compared to other Arena vehicles, the Scarab excels in armor resistance, able to take up to six rockets before being destroyed. However, its windshield is pretty large, leaving the front occupants vulnerable to gunfire, with little to no protection for the rear passengers. The Full Armor plate solves the issue with the front occupants, which leaves a smaller weak spot on the windshield. However, there is no option for the rear bed to protect the rear passengers.

Weaponry[]

  • The vehicle can be fitted with a Ram Weapon. The ram weapon behaves in a similar way to the updated scoops and ramming bars of the RCV and Armored Boxville, causing a large amount of damage to other vehicles and often sending them flying into mid-air with little to no disadvantage against the vehicle itself, and no damage to the vehicle's engine whatsoever. It should be noted that the effectiveness against other players is significantly reduced compared to its effectiveness against NPCs and their vehicles.
  • Mounted .50 Cal: The Scarab can be modified to have a single machine gun, which behaves similarly to other front-mounted machine guns from various armed land vehicles. While having good damage against most targets, it struggles to defeat heavily-armored vehicles.
  • Mounted Laser: The Scarab, like other Future Shock vehicles, has access to a phased plasma gun, which seems to have higher fire rate but retain the same damage per round as the regular machine gun.
  • The vehicle has the option for installing Proximity Mines. Unlike Weaponized Vehicles added in the Gunrunning update, the Scarab, along with all Arena Cars in the Arena War update, has five different Proximity Mine choices: Kinetic, Spike, EMP, Slick and Sticky;
    • The Kinetic option (orange flashing light) creates a small impulse spreading several meters around the area, sending players and vehicles into the air. The impulse deals little damage to both players and vehicles.
    • The Spike option (dark blue flashing light) bursts the tires of vehicles passing over or near it, as well as dealing a small amount of damage to the vehicle, mainly effecting the vehicle's windows, but otherwise dealing no damage or force. The mine does not burst vehicles with Bulletproof Tires installed.
    • The EMP option (light blue flashing light) disables the vehicle's electronics when passing over it. The accelerator, brakes and steering, as well as the radio and other features are disabled for around 5 seconds before reactivating. It also deals a small amount of damage to players. The player will be notified by whom their vehicle was disabled by in a small notification above the radar.
    • The Slick option (green flashing light) bursts a large amount of oil on the surface, causing vehicles passing over it to lose control. This deals no damage to both vehicles or players.
    • The Sticky option (purple flashing light) bursts a large amount of sticky substance on the surface, causing vehicles passing over it to slow down. This deals no damage to both vehicles or players.
  • The tank can also be installed with bodywork Spikes. These spikes deal damage to NPCs and players, contact with the spikes can instantly kill them.

Locations[]

Grand Theft Auto Online[]

  • Can be purchased at the Arena War website for $3,076,290 or $2,313,000 (trade price as a Sponsorship Tier reward in the Arena War Career).
    • The vehicle comes with the "HK" Livery and a Light Scoop Ram Weapon as standard when purchased.

Bugs/Glitches[]

Grand Theft Auto Online[]

  • Certain modifications on the "Engine Covers" group may cause a visual bug on the side badges:
    • When applying the Livery Roof, the badge will be mapped incorrectly.
    • When applying the Heavy Duty Cooling, the badge will be inverted.
